  • BACKGROUND With the rapid development of mobile communication technologies, Location Based Service (LBS) has attracted more and more attention, and applications of LBS in intelligent transportation, emergency rescue, workflow management, property monitoring, etc. It is quite common, and the basis for providing these LBS services is mobile positioning technology. At present, mobile positioning technology can be divided into satellite-based positioning technology, WiFi-based positioning technology and mobile cellular network (Cellid)-based positioning technology.
  • satellite-based positioning technologies mainly include Global Position System (GPS), GLONASS (GLONASS, Russian satellite navigation system), and Beidou.
  • GPS Global Position System
  • GLONASS GLONASS
  • Beidou Beidou.
  • the basic principle of GPS positioning is to take the position of the high-speed moving satellite as the known calculation data, and use the spatial distance resection method to calculate the position of the point to be measured. It requires the GPS receiver to receive 4 pieces at a certain time.
  • the above GPS satellite signals The GPS positioning technology has the characteristics of high positioning accuracy, but it is only suitable for positioning in an outdoor open environment. It is difficult to achieve positioning due to the occlusion of satellite signals in indoor and high-rise urban environments.
  • WiFi positioning Since the location of the WiFi hotspot is relatively fixed, it generally changes little. If the latitude and longitude coordinates of each WiFi hotspot can be known in advance, the latitude and longitude coordinates corresponding to the hotspot can be queried according to the WiFi hotspot information searched by the mobile terminal, thereby realizing Positioning.
  • WiFi positioning has the advantages of fast positioning speed and high positioning accuracy, which is very suitable for positioning in places where population and building groups are dense.
  • the disadvantages are: Sometimes there will be artificially moving the WiFi location (such as moving the wireless router from one place to another), at this time, if you rely solely on WiFi positioning, it may cause a positioning error.
  • the CelllD positioning principle is similar to the WiFi positioning principle.
  • the positioning server stores the latitude and longitude information of each base station in advance.
  • the mobile terminal sends the currently searched base station information to the positioning server, and the positioning server receives the information according to the received information.
  • the base station information can query the latitude and longitude coordinates corresponding to the base station, and return the latitude and longitude coordinates to the mobile terminal as the current location of the mobile terminal, so that the mobile terminal is Now positioned.
  • CelllD has a fast positioning speed, its positioning accuracy is very low, and it is difficult to meet the demand for high-precision positioning.

本发明涉及一种移动终端定位方法、装置及移动终端,其方法包括:接收应用服务器发起的定位请求;根据定位请求分别发起WiFi定位流程和CellID定位流程,并分别获取WiFi定位结果和CellID定位结果;采用预定规则对WiFi定位结果和CellID定位结果进行处理,获取最终定位结果。本发明由于综合考虑了WiFi定位结果和CellID定位结果,从而解决了单独依靠WiFi定位在WiFi位置变动后导致定位错误、单独依靠CellID定位存在的定位精度低的问题,提高了移动终端定位的准确性和定位精度。

技术领域 本发明涉及移动通信技术领域, 尤其涉及一种无线保真 (Wireless Fidelity, 简称 为 WiFi) 定位和移动蜂窝网络小区标识 (CelllD) 定位相结合的移动终端定位方法、 装置及移动终端。 背景技术 随着移动通信技术的迅速发展, 基于位置的服务(Location Based Service, 简称为 LBS) 越来越受到人们的关注, LBS在智能交通、 紧急救援、 工作流管理、 财产监控 等方面的应用已相当普遍, 而提供这些 LBS服务的基础就是移动定位技术。 目前,移动定位技术可以分为基于卫星的定位技术、基于 WiFi的定位技术和基于 移动蜂窝网络 (Cellid) 的定位技术。 其中, 基于卫星的定位技术主要有全球定位系统(Global Position System, 简称为 GPS)、 格洛纳斯导航系统 (GLONASS, 俄罗斯的卫星导航系统) 以及北斗等。 GPS 定位的基本原理是把高速运动的卫星瞬时所在的位置作为已知的计算数据, 采用空间 距离后方交会的方法来计算待测点的位置,它要求 GPS接收机在某一时刻接收 4颗及 以上的 GPS卫星信号。 GPS定位技术具有定位精度高的特点, 但是它只适合在室外开 阔环境中进行定位, 在室内及高楼林立的城市环境中由于卫星信号受到遮挡而很难实 现定位。
WiFi定位的原理是: 由于 WiFi热点位置比较固定, 一般很少变动, 如果能事先 知道各个 WiFi热点的经纬度坐标, 就可以根据移动终端搜索到的 WiFi热点信息查询 该热点对应的经纬度坐标, 进而实现定位。 WiFi定位具有定位速度快, 定位精度高, 非常适合在人口、 楼群越密集的地方进行定位的特点。 但是, 其缺点在于: 有时候会 有人为的挪动 WiFi位置的情况(比如搬家把无线路由器从一个地方挪到另一个地方), 此时, 若单纯依靠 WiFi定位就可能造成定位错误的情况。 CelllD定位原理和 WiFi定位原理相似,定位服务器会事先存储每个基站的经纬度 信息, 移动终端在向定位服务器请求位置信息时, 会把当前搜索到的基站信息发送给 定位服务器,定位服务器根据收到的基站信息就可以查询到该基站对应的经纬度坐标, 并把该经纬度坐标返回给移动终端作为移动终端当前所在的位置, 这样移动终端就实 现了定位。 CelllD虽然定位速度快, 但是其定位精度很低, 很难满足高精度定位的需 求。 通常对于用户而言, 首先考虑的是定位位置的正确性, 其次是定位的精度, 如果 在室外开阔地带, GPS自然是用户的首选定位方式, 但是如果在室内或高楼林立的不 适合 GPS定位的环境,则要考虑使用 WiFi或 CelllD进行定位。而单独使用 WiFi定位, 如果 WiFi位置被人为挪动(比如搬家)就有可能出现定位错误的情况, 这对用户来说 是无法接受的; 如果单独使用 CelllD定位, 由于基站位置不会轻易的被挪动, 因此定 位位置不会有大的错误, 但是定位精度却较低。 发明内容 本发明实施例提供了一种移动终端定位方法、 装置及移动终端, 旨在提高移动终 端定位的准确性和定位精度。 为了达到上述目的, 本发明实施例提出了一种移动终端定位方法, 包括: 接收应 用服务器发起的定位请求; 根据所述定位请求分别发起 WiFi定位流程和 CelllD定位 流程, 并分别获取 WiFi定位结果和 CelllD定位结果; 采用预定规则对所述 WiFi定位 结果和 CelllD定位结果进行处理, 获取最终定位结果。 优选地, 所述根据定位请求发起 WiFi定位流程获取 WiFi定位结果的步骤包括: WiFi定位模块向 WiFi定位服务器发送当前探测到的 WiFi热点信息并请求定位结果; WiFi定位模块接收所述 WiFi定位服务器返回的 WiFi定位结果。 优选地,所述根据定位请求发起 CelllD定位流程获取 CelllD定位结果的步骤包括: CelllD 定位模块向 CelllD 定位服务器发送当前探测到的移动网络信息并请求定位结 果; CelllD定位模块接收所述 CelllD定位服务器返回的 CelllD定位结果。 优选地, 所述采用预定规则对所述 WiFi定位结果和 CelllD定位结果进行处理, 获取最终定位结果的步骤包括: 将所述 WiFi定位结果和 CelllD定位结果进行比较; 若所述 WiFi定位结果与 CelllD定位结果之间的差值小于预设阈值, 则以所述 WiFi定 位结果作为最终定位结果; 否则, 以所述 CelllD定位结果作为最终定位结果。 优选地, 该方法还包括: 将获取的所述最终定位结果返回给所述应用服务器。 本发明实施例还提出了一种移动终端定位装置,包括:接收模块、 WiFi定位模块、 CelllD定位模块及数据处理模块, 其中: 所述接收模块设置为接收应用服务器发起的 定位请求; 所述 WiFi 定位模块设置为根据所述定位请求发起 WiFi 定位流程, 获取 WiFi定位结果, 并将所述 WiFi定位结果发送给所述数据处理模块; 所述 CelllD定位 模块设置为根据所述定位请求发起 CelllD定位流程, 获取 CelllD定位结果, 并将所述 CelllD定位结果发送给所述数据处理模块; 所述数据处理模块设置为采用预定规则对 所述 WiFi定位结果和 CelllD定位结果进行处理, 获取最终定位结果。 优选地,所述 WiFi定位模块还设置为向 WiFi定位服务器发送当前探测到的 WiFi 热点信息并请求定位结果; 接收所述 WiFi定位服务器返回的 WiFi定位结果。 优选地,所述 CelllD定位模块还设置为向 CelllD定位服务器发送当前探测到的移 动网络信息并请求定位结果; 接收所述 CelllD定位服务器返回的 CelllD定位结果。 优选地, 所述数据处理模块还设置为将所述 WiFi定位结果和 CelllD定位结果进 行比较; 若所述 WiFi定位结果与 CelllD定位结果之间的差值小于预设阈值, 则以所 述 WiFi定位结果作为最终定位结果; 否则, 以所述 CelllD定位结果作为最终定位结 果。 优选地,所述数据处理模块还设置为将所述最终定位结果返回给所述应用服务器。 本发明实施例还提出了一种移动终端, 包括如上所述的装置。 本发明实施例提出的移动终端定位方法、 装置及移动终端, 在需要定位时, 根据 定位请求分别发起 WiFi定位流程和 CelllD定位流程,获取 WiFi定位结果和 CelllD定 位结果, 然后对该 WiFi定位结果和 CelllD定位结果采用一定的规则进行处理, 得到 最终定位结果, 由于综合考虑了 WiFi定位结果和 CelllD定位结果, 从而解决了单独 依靠 WiFi定位在 WiFi位置变动后导致定位错误、单独依靠 CelllD定位存在的定位精 度低的问题, 提高了移动终端定位的准确性和定位精度。 附图说明 图 1是本发明实施例的移动终端定位方法一的流程示意图; 图 2 是本发明实施例的移动终端定位方法一的优选流程示意图; 图 3是本发明实施例的移动终端定位装置一的结构示意图。 为了使本发明的技术方案更加清楚、 明了, 下面将结合附图作进一步详述。 具体实施方式 本发明实施例的方案是: 在需要定位时,根据定位请求分别发起 WiFi定位流程和 CelllD定位流程, 获取 WiFi定位结果和 CelllD定位结果, 然后对该 WiFi定位结果和 CelllD定位结果采用一定的规则进行处理, 得到最终定位结果, 以解决单独依靠 WiFi 定位在 WiFi位置变动后导致定位错误、 单独依靠 CelllD定位存在的定位精度低的问 题, 提高移动终端定位的准确性和定位精度。 本发明实施例中移动终端具有 WiFi定位和 CelllD定位功能。 如图 1所示, 本发明实施例提出了一种移动终端定位方法, 包括: 步骤 S101, 接收应用服务器发起的定位请求; 本实施例方法运行环境涉及移动终端、对移动终端进行定位的 WiFi定位服务器和

CelllD定位模块接收到 CelllD定位服务器返回的 CelllD定位结果后, 把 CelllD 定位结果发送给数据处理模块进行处理。 步骤 S103, 采用预定规则对所述 WiFi定位结果和 CelllD定位结果进行处理, 获 取最终定位结果。 数据处理模块对 WiFi定位结果和 CelllD定位结果进行处理, 以决定最终的定位 结果。 处理规则可以包括: 如果 WiFi定位结果和 CelllD定位结果相差小于预设阈值比 如 2千米 (该值由 CelllD的定位精度确定, 由于 CelllD的定位精度一般是 1~2千米, 所以这里可以取最大误差 2千米), 则认为 WiFi定位有效, 由于 WiFi定位精度更高, 此时使用 WiFi定位结果作为最终的定位结果; 否则认为 WiFi定位结果无效 (这种情 况下一般是 WiFi位置变动导致), 使用 CelllD定位结果作为最终的定位结果。 之后, 数据处理模块把最终的定位结果返回给应用服务器。 本实施例处理流程如图 2所示。 本实施例通过上述方案, 综合考虑了 WiFi定位结果和 CelllD定位结果, 从而解 决了单独依靠 WiFi定位在 WiFi位置变动后导致定位错误、单独依靠 CelllD定位存在 的定位精度低的问题, 提高了移动终端定位的准确性和定位精度。 如图 3所示, 本发明实施例提出了一种移动终端定位装置, 包括: 接收模块 200、
